The Royal Challengers Bangalore are a franchise cricket team based in Bengaluru, Karnataka, that plays in the Indian Premier League. One of the original eight teams in the IPL, the team has made three final appearances in the IPL, losing all. The team also finished runners-up in the 2011 CLT20, losing the final against the Mumbai Indians.The home ground of the Royal Challengers is the M. Chinnaswamy Stadium in Bengaluru. The team is currently captained by Virat Kohli and coached by Gary Kirsten. The team holds the records of both the highest and the lowest total in the IPL. Read More
